Schindler’s List is a 1993 biographical film directed by Steven Spielberg and written by Steven Zaillian, telling the story of Oscar Schindler, a German businessman who saved the lives of more than one thousand Polish Jews during the Holocaust. It was based on the novel Schindler’s Ark by Thomas Keneally, and starred Liam Neeson as Schindler, Ralph Fiennes as Schutzstaffel officer Amon Göeth, and Ben Kingsley as Schindler’s accountant Itzhak Stern. The film was both a box office success and recipient of seven Academy Awards, including Best Picture, Best Director and Best Score.
